编程猫面试会问些什么问题
-
在编程猫面试中,面试官通常会问一些与编程技能、算法知识和软技能相关的问题。以下是一些可能会在编程猫面试中被问到的常见问题:
-
介绍一下自己:面试官会要求你自我介绍,让他们了解你的背景、教育经历和工作经验。
-
编程语言和技术:他们可能会问你在哪些编程语言和技术上有经验,以及你对这些技术的了解程度。
-
项目经验:面试官可能会要求你介绍你在过去的项目中扮演的角色,以及你在项目中遇到的挑战和解决方案。
-
数据结构和算法:编程猫面试通常会涉及对数据结构和算法的理解和应用。你可能会被要求解释各种数据结构的概念,并且需要给出实际应用的例子。
-
编程问题:面试官可能会问你一些具体的编程问题,测试你的编程能力。这些问题可能涉及字符串处理、数组操作、递归等。
-
系统设计:在面试过程中,面试官可能会要求你设计一个系统,例如一个在线商城或一个社交媒体平台。你需要考虑到系统的架构、数据库设计和性能优化等方面。
-
解决问题的能力:面试官可能会提出一些实际问题,测试你解决问题的能力和思维方式。这些问题可能是关于如何处理复杂的任务、如何优化性能或如何调试代码等。
-
团队合作和沟通能力:编程猫注重团队合作和沟通能力,因此面试官可能会问你在过去的项目中如何与团队成员合作、如何解决冲突以及如何有效地沟通。
在编程猫面试中,除了技术问题,面试官还会评估你的解决问题的能力、学习能力、自我驱动和对团队的贡献能力。因此,在回答问题时,除了简洁明了地回答问题,还要展示出你的思考过程和解决问题的能力。
1年前 -
-
在编程猫面试中,面试官通常会问一系列与编程和计算机科学相关的问题,以评估面试者的技能和知识水平。以下是一些常见的编程猫面试问题:
-
介绍一下你对编程猫的了解。
这个问题旨在了解面试者对编程猫平台的熟悉程度,面试者可以介绍编程猫的特点、功能以及如何在其中进行编程学习。 -
你在编程方面有什么经验和技能?
面试官可能会要求面试者介绍自己在编程方面的经验和技能。面试者可以提及自己掌握的编程语言、开发工具以及参与过的项目经验。 -
请解释一下什么是算法和数据结构。
这是一个基础的问题,面试者需要清楚地解释算法和数据结构的概念,并能举例说明各自的应用场景。 -
你有使用过编程猫平台进行编程学习吗?
如果面试者有使用过编程猫进行编程学习,面试官可能会进一步询问他们在平台上学到了哪些知识和技能,以及使用编程猫的体验如何。 -
请编写一个简单的程序来解决某个问题。
面试官可能会要求面试者编写一个简单的程序来解决一个具体问题,以评估他们的编程能力和解决问题的能力。 -
请解释一下什么是面向对象编程(OOP)。
面向对象编程是一种编程范式,面试者需要能够清楚地解释OOP的概念,并举例说明如何使用面向对象编程来解决问题。 -
请解释一下什么是版本控制系统(VCS)。
版本控制系统是一种用于管理和跟踪代码变更的工具,面试者需要能够解释版本控制系统的作用、常用的版本控制系统以及如何使用它们。 -
请解释一下什么是云计算。
云计算是一种通过互联网提供计算资源的模式,面试者需要能够清楚地解释云计算的概念、优势以及在实际应用中的应用场景。 -
请解释一下什么是数据库和数据库管理系统(DBMS)。
面试者需要清楚地解释数据库的概念,以及数据库管理系统的作用和功能,同时还需要能够举例说明常见的数据库管理系统和它们的应用场景。 -
请解释一下什么是网络协议和IP地址。
面试者需要清楚地解释网络协议的概念和作用,以及IP地址的作用和分类。他们还需要能够解释TCP/IP协议栈和常见的网络协议。
1年前 -
-
在面试过程中,编程猫可能会问到一些常见的编程问题,以评估应聘者的技术能力和解决问题的能力。以下是一些可能被问到的问题示例:
- 介绍编程猫的特点和优势。
- 你对编程猫有什么了解?你觉得编程猫有哪些创新点?
- 请简要介绍一下你的项目经验。
- 你最擅长的编程语言是什么?为什么?
- 你在什么场景下使用过编程猫,有什么具体体验和感受?
- 请列举一些你熟悉的编程语言和框架,并描述它们的特点和适用场景。
- 你在编程过程中遇到的最大挑战是什么,你是如何解决的?
- 请举一个你在团队合作中的成功案例,并描述你的角色和贡献。
- 你如何处理代码冲突和版本控制?
- 请解释一下前端和后端的区别,并描述它们之间的协作流程。
- 你在Web开发中使用过的前端框架和工具有哪些,分别用来解决什么问题?
- 请描述一下你对数据库的理解,以及你使用过的数据库类型和工具。
- 你在项目中遇到过性能问题,你是如何解决的?
- 请列举一些你熟悉的网络安全问题和防护方法。
- 你有什么自我学习的方法和习惯?你如何保持对新技术的学习和更新?
- 你有什么问题想要问编程猫的面试官?
以上问题只是一些示例,实际面试中可能会根据具体职位和应聘者的经验进行调整。应聘者在准备面试前,可以对这些问题进行思考和准备,以便在面试中更好地展示自己的技能和经验。
1年前